Understanding Zoning Laws

Zoning laws are municipal regulations that dictate how properties within certain areas can be used. For multifamily developers, understanding these laws is crucial for determining the viability of a potential project. Zoning dictates not only the size and height of the buildings but also their intended use, which in this case is residential.

Developers must engage with local zoning boards early in the planning process to ensure compliance. Non-compliance can result in costly delays or changes that can impact project feasibility. Zoning laws are designed to maintain orderly development within a region, prevent overcrowding, and ensure the proper allocation of resources and infrastructure.

The Role of Entitlements

Entitlements are legal rights granted by the government that allow developers to use land for particular purposes. In the realm of multifamily development, acquiring the necessary entitlements is a critical step that often involves negotiations with local authorities. This includes securing permits for land use, construction, and environmental compliance.

Challenges and Opportunities

While the zoning and entitlement process can be cumbersome, it also presents opportunities for savvy developers to differentiate their projects. Understanding local government priorities, such as affordable housing initiatives, can highlight opportunities for mutually beneficial negotiations.

Moreover, navigating these processes effectively can lead to projects that not only comply with regulations but also integrate seamlessly into the community, enhancing long-term value and tenant satisfaction.
